How much do applications eng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for applications engineer in Augusta, GA is $104,057.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$79,000.00 and $126,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an applications engineer?

Applications Engineers are technical professionals who work at the intersection of engineering and customer support. They help clients understand, implement, and optimize the use of a company's products, often by providing technical expertise, troubleshooting, and customized solutions. Applications Engineers may collaborate closely with sales, product development, and customers to ensure products meet specific application requirements. Their role often involves both pre-sales and post-sales support, technical demonstrations, and training.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an applications eng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Applications Engineer, you need a solid background in engineering principles, problem-solving abilities, and a relevant degree such as electrical, mechanical, or software engineering. Familiarity with CAD software, simulation tools, programming languages, and industry-specific certifications like Six Sigma or PMP are commonly required. Excellent communication, teamwork, and customer-oriented skills help you bridge the gap between technical teams and clients. These competencies ensure effective product implementation, client satisfaction, and successful project outcomes in a technical environment.

How does an applications engineer typically collaborate with product development and sales teams?

Applications Engineers play a crucial role as liaisons between technical teams and customers. They often work closely with product development to relay customer feedback, suggest design improvements, and help troubleshoot application-specific issues. Additionally, they support sales teams by providing technical expertise during client meetings and demonstrations, ensuring customer requirements are understood and addressed. This collaboration helps align customer needs with product capabilities and enhances overall customer satisfaction.

What is the difference between Applications Engineer vs Mechanical Engineer?

AspectApplications EngineerMechanical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in engineering or related field, often with industry-specific certificationsBachelor's or higher in mechanical engineering, often with licensure or professional engineer (PE) license
Work EnvironmentCustomer-facing, technical support, product demonstrations, and sales collaborationDesign, analysis, manufacturing, and testing in labs or manufacturing plants
Employer & Industry UsageTech companies, manufacturing, industrial equipment, and engineering servicesAutomotive, aerospace, manufacturing, and energy sectors

Applications Engineers focus on technical support, product demonstrations, and customer interaction, often requiring strong communication skills. Mechanical Engineers primarily work on designing, analyzing, and testing mechanical systems. While both roles require engineering degrees, their work environments and daily tasks differ significantly, catering to different aspects of engineering and customer engagement.

What does an Applications Engineer do?

An Applications Engineer designs, develops, and supports technical solutions for customers, often providing product demonstrations, troubleshooting, and technical support. They work closely with sales and engineering teams to customize products to meet client needs and may use tools like CAD software or testing equipment. Strong communication skills and technical knowledge are essential for explaining complex concepts clearly.

Position Overview

CESI is seeking a highly motivated Cyber Range Engineer to join the Range Operations team working in the Persistent Cyber Training Environment - Operations Group (PCTE-OG). The Cyber Range Engineer will design, implement, and maintain advanced cyber training environments. The successful candidate possesses hands-on experience in both Windows and Linux systems, virtualized infrastructures, and cybersecurity tools, with the ability to develop, deploy, and troubleshoot complex training scenarios.

The position is full-time on-site.

Responsibilities
  • Support the planning, build, and execution of cybersecurity training, mission rehearsal, and validation events within cyber range environments.
  • Build and configure cyber range content (virtual machines, virtual networks, accounts/roles, tooling, and exercise injects) to meet event objectives and scenario design.
  • Implement and operate offensive and defensive training content, including red cell tools, defensive sensors, and supporting applications, under established design guidance.
  • Provide event support during execution windows, including environment readiness checks, user access support, troubleshooting, and rapid issue resolution.
  • Configure and maintain Windows and Linux hosts used in training environments, including patching, baseline configuration, and restoration of lab state as required.
  • Deliver virtual infrastructure and network support (VMware, routing/switching constructs, DNS, TCP/IP), including diagnosing connectivity and performance issues across range enclaves.
  • Coordinate with content developers, exercise staff, and stakeholders to capture requirements, track tasks, and communicate status, risks, and impacts.
  • Develop and update technical documentation (build notes, runbooks, diagrams, and after-action inputs) to support repeatable event delivery and knowledge transfer.
  • Identify repeat issues and contribute to continuous improvement by recommending and implementing process, automation, or standard configuration updates.
Required Experience/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in a technical discipline such as information technology, computer science, systems or software engineering from an accredited college or university or 6 years of relevant experience can be substituted for degree.
  • 5+ years of combined experience with Computer Network Operations (CNO)/ Computer Network Exploitation (CNE)/ Computer Network Defense (CND) platforms, cyber training, validation exercises, and working with cyber protection teams (CPTs), including planning, coordinating, and execution.ย ย 
  • Current DoD 8140/8570 IAT Level II Certification
  • Relevant networking engineering certification
  • Relevant Cloud/VMware certification
  • Relevant certification in RedHat/Linux/Windowsย 
  • Working knowledge and hands-on experience in both Windows and Linux operating system environments.
  • Experience working with VMware and supporting systems within virtualized environments.
  • Proven ability to troubleshoot network connectivity, performance, and configuration issues involving DNS, routing, and TCP/IP.
  • Intermediate knowledge of defensive and offensive cyber tools and techniques.
  • Must be a self-starter in a fast-paced environment and able to work with a range of engineers holding a diverse set of skills at differing levels of experience.
  • Effective written and oral communication with multiple levels of leadership involving both business and technical sides of the business. ย 
  • Able to prioritize multiple tasks, projects, and demands.ย 
Preferred Experience/Qualifications
  • Familiarity with or experience supporting the Joint Event Life Cycle (JELC).
  • Experience supporting cyber training and validation exercises, including planning, coordination, and execution with Cyber Protection Teams (CPTs).
  • Experience using SIEMs, intrusion detection systems, or threat intelligence platforms to support cybersecurity operations.
  • Experience using scripting or automation tools to streamline cybersecurity operations or environment setup.
